RF Connectors
SMP Connectors
-
The SMP interface is a subminiature interface in the same scale as MMCX connectors but offers a frequency range of DC to 40 GHz. It is commonly used in miniaturized high frequency coaxial modules and is offered in both push-on and snap-on mating styles.

RF Connectors
HD-BNC Connectors
-
The HD-BNC product line delivers both true 50 and 75 ohm performance in a footprint 4 times smaller than traditional BNC connectors. Using the same cable prep and termination specifications of legacy broadcast connectors makes adopting HD-BNC seamless.

RF Connectors
AMC4 Connectors
-
The AMC4 (Amphenol Micro Coaxial, 4th Generation) connector series is a low profile (0.6 mm height off the board) series with an extremely small board footprint (2 mm x 2 mm).

RF Connectors
MMCX Connectors
-
The MMCX (Micro-Miniature Coaxial) connector series is a micro-miniature version of the MCX. It is a 50 ohm impedance interface with broadband capability of DC to 6 GHz and secure, fast and easy snap-on/snap-off coupling. MMCX connectors have a smaller footprint than the MCX series, and are available in a wide array of configurations.

RF Adapters
TNC Adapters
-
Amphenol RF offers a wide array of both in-series and between-series TNC adapters in straight and right-angle configurations. 50-ohm and 75-ohm impedance TNC adapters are available with and without panel mounting features. Popular mounting features in bulkhead, both front and rear mount, and 4-hole flange designs. 50-ohm TNC connectors have a frequency range from DC to 11 GHz. 75-ohm TNC connectors have a maximum frequency of 3 GHz.
